如何优化Linux系统的性能并提升应用程序的运行速度? Linux系统是一款非常稳定且功能丰富的操作系统。然而,随着应用程序的不断增加,通常会导致系统变得缓慢,响应速度也变慢。本文将介绍如何优化Linux系统的性能并提升应用程序的运行速度。 1. 检查系统资源使用情况 在优化Linux系统性能之前,我们需要先了解系统的资源使用情况。有些应用程序可能会占用大量的内存或CPU资源,导致系统响应变慢。通过top或htop等工具可以查看系统资源的使用情况,并找出导致系统响应变慢的应用程序。 2. 使用SSD硬盘 SSD硬盘相比于传统的机械硬盘具有更快的读写速度,可以显著提高系统性能和应用程序的运行速度。将系统安装在SSD硬盘上可以大大加快系统启动和文件读写速度,从而提高系统的响应速度。 3. 禁用不必要的服务和进程 在Linux系统中有很多预置的服务和进程,有些服务和进程可能并没有使用到,但是会占用系统资源。可以通过systemctl命令禁用一些不必要的服务和进程来释放系统资源,并提高系统性能。 4. 使用能效较高的软件 在安装应用程序时,选择能效较高的软件会提高系统的性能。例如,使用MATE桌面环境会比GNOME桌面环境更加省电,从而提高系统性能。 5. 使用缓存 使用缓存可以减少重复读取数据的次数,从而提高系统和应用程序的响应速度。Linux系统缓存机制可通过修改sysctl.conf配置文件中的相关参数来进行调整。例如: vm.swappiness = 10 # 调整交换分区使用率 vm.dirty_ratio = 60 # 调整脏页在内存中的占比 vm.dirty_background_ratio = 20 # 调整后台脏页在内存中的占比 6. 更新内核和驱动程序 更新内核和驱动程序可以及时修复一些漏洞和问题,并提高系统的稳定性和性能。可以通过升级指令或使用更新管理工具来进行内核和驱动程序的更新。 总结 通过上述方法,我们可以优化Linux系统的性能并提升应用程序的运行速度。采用这些技巧可以大大提高系统的响应速度和稳定性,提高工作和使用效率。